BioShock 2 Metro Pack out on PC

Alongside patch, Character Pack.

2K Games has released the BioShock 2 Metro Pack DLC on PC.

The content went live yesterday and coincides with the release of a new PC patch.

The Metro Pack adds new maps, Achievements, trials and masks, and costs 800 Microsoft Points.

2K has also released the Character Pack for BioShock 2 on PC. Inside are Zigo the Fisherman and Blanche the Actress skins. These cost 160 Microsoft Points.

The Metro Pack has already been released on PS3 and Xbox 360. There, users are experiencing a few problems.
